AFES KITS NON-REDUCIBLE HEIGHTPN 3958689 is a federal award for Commander held by Oshkosh Defense, LLC. Estimated value $5.7M ($5.7M obligated). Current period of performance ends Aug 29, 2022. Place of performance: OSHKOSH WI. Related solicitation M6785418R0010.
